
Less than a week after the award was announced, the National Nuclear Security Administration on Wednesday canceled the new contract for management and operation of the Nevada National Security Site. That puts the multibillion-dollar deal back in play, though only for the companies that submitted bids in the first go-around; new parties are not being accepted, according to the semiautonomous Department of Energy agency.
